Restaurants on Puerto Vallarta’s Malecon are open, but the customers aren’t ready to visit

Although more than 20 restaurants are already open on the Malecon in Puerto Vallarta, its reopening has not met the expectations of the local restaurant association, according to Sergio Jaime Santos., president of the Canirac in Puerto Vallarta and Bahía de Banderas.

Despite the fact that the openings have been motivating for the association, it has not fulfilled the expectations that restaurants had hoped for, nevertheless, according to the restaurant leader, the adjustments to enter the so-called "new normality" continue.
